Standard on EDNC Series and EDGE Series machines with MGH controller, Super Spark II(TM) power supply adjustment option can reduce part finishing time by up to 20%, regardless of shape, size, or cavity depth. Installation, training, prove-out, and data documentation are included.

V-Series vertical machining centers incorporate SGI.4 geometric intelligence technology, which enables processing of long, complex mold programs. On-the-fly, 3D compensation allows machining centers to track precisely programmed toolpath on mold contours and complex geometries 5 times faster than feed rates of conventional machines. Read More »Integral Drive Spindle delivers 744 lb-ft from 0-392 rpm.
Featuring CAT 50-taper toolholder, high-torque spindle offers accel/decel ranges of 1.5 sec at 4,000 rpm or 4.3 sec at 8,000 rpm. It employs 50 hp from 2,000-5,000 rpm, making it suited for difficult cutting scenarios with hard metals such as stainless steel, titanium, nickel-based alloys, cast or ductile iron, and compacted graphite iron. Utilizing 11.3 hp continuous, 40,000 rpm spindle, V22 VMC machines materials such as ceramics with intricate cores and cavities. It employs core cooling and under-race lubrication system, and handles 220 lb load and 17.7 x 18.7 x 7 in. max workpiece.
